Understanding the Role of AI in Business Transformation
The rise of Artificial Intelligence (AI) is more than just a technological shift; it represents a paradigm change that affects how businesses operate across various sectors. As companies embrace AI, they are finding innovative ways to deal with challenges and leverage opportunities that arise in an increasingly digital marketplace.
One of the most significant advantages of AI lies in its data analysis capabilities. In today’s data-driven world, organizations generate enormous quantities of information daily. AI can sift through this data with remarkable speed, using advanced algorithms to uncover patterns and insights. For example, retailers often utilize AI tools that analyze consumer purchasing behavior, enabling them to adjust inventory levels or marketing strategies in real time. This ability to harness data can lead to enhanced decision-making, ultimately boosting profitability.
Equally impactful is the automation aspect of AI. Many repetitive tasks that previously consumed countless human hours can now be handled by intelligent systems. This shift frees employees to concentrate on more critical, strategic work. Take, for instance, customer service departments that utilize AI chatbots. These bots can resolve common queries swiftly, allowing human agents to focus on complex issues that require a personal touch. This not only enhances efficiency but often leads to greater **customer satisfaction**, as customers receive faster responses to their inquiries.
Furthermore, AI excels in providing personalization in consumer markets. As companies gather data on individual preferences and behaviors, AI algorithms can create tailored shopping experiences. For example, streaming services like Netflix and Spotify leverage AI algorithms to suggest shows or songs that cater specifically to user tastes, significantly enhancing user engagement and reducing churn rates. Personalized recommendations foster a deeper connection between businesses and their consumers, encouraging loyalty and repeat purchases.
The impact of AI is especially pronounced in various industries. In retail, AI algorithms underpin recommendation systems that analyze customer data to suggest products. This can lead to significant sales increases, as shoppers are more likely to purchase items that align with their interests. Similarly, in the finance sector, AI tools enable rapid algorithmic trading, allowing firms to capitalize on stock market fluctuations more efficiently than ever before. The risk assessment models also developed through AI ensure that companies make informed lending decisions, minimizing potential losses.
In healthcare, AI provides groundbreaking advancements through predictive analytics, which can foresee patient complications before they become serious, enabling preventive care strategies. For instance, hospitals employing AI systems to analyze patient data can optimize the allocation of resources, ensuring that the right care reaches the right patient promptly.
As AI continues to permeate different aspects of business, understanding these transformative effects is vital for stakeholders aiming to thrive in the dynamic marketplace. By recognizing how AI reshapes not only individual organizations but the overall competitive landscape, businesses can strategically position themselves to leverage these technologies for sustained growth and success.

The Advantages of AI in Modern Business Environments
The incorporation of Artificial Intelligence (AI) into various business functions has led to essential advancements that are reshaping global markets. With its ability to analyze vast amounts of data and automate processes, AI presents several distinct advantages for organizations that choose to adopt these technologies.
One of the most critical benefits is enhanced operational efficiency. Companies can now streamline operations by integrating AI-powered systems that handle tedious and time-consuming tasks. This not only reduces costs but also leads to significant time savings. For example, a manufacturing plant utilizing AI-driven robotics can quickly adjust its production line based on market demand, ensuring that products are produced just in time without surplus inventory. This responsiveness helps businesses adapt to market changes rapidly.
Another integral advantage is found in predictive analytics. By leveraging AI models that analyze historical data, businesses can anticipate market trends and consumer behavior with greater accuracy. This foresight enables organizations to make proactive decisions rather than reactive ones. Retailers, for instance, can utilize AI to predict which products are likely to sell well during specific seasons, allowing them to stock up accordingly and optimize their marketing strategies.
Moreover, AI contributes to improved risk management. Businesses associated with high-stakes environments, such as finance and insurance, are now using sophisticated AI algorithms to assess risks associated with investments or underwriting policies. These systems can evaluate a multitude of factors, including market fluctuations and demographic trends, leading to more informed decision-making. For example:
- Credit Risk Assessment: Financial institutions employ AI to analyze credit histories and predict an applicant’s likelihood of defaulting on loans, allowing them to offer loans with appropriate terms.
- Fraud Detection: AI can monitor transactions in real-time, flagging any unusual patterns that suggest fraudulent activity, thereby safeguarding companies and consumers alike.
- Supply Chain Management: AI tools can forecast disruptions across the supply chain, enabling businesses to devise contingency plans and mitigate impacts on operations.
Furthermore, the global reach of AI technology promotes opportunities for businesses to enter new markets. With AI-driven tools that simplify language translation and cultural understanding, companies can engage with diverse customer bases more effectively. For instance, global e-commerce platforms utilize AI to tailor their online interfaces and marketing campaigns to cater to localized preferences and languages, thus enhancing customer engagement and driving sales growth.
As organizations continue to harness the potential of AI, they are not just evolving internally; they are influencing the overall dynamics of global markets. A strategic approach toward these technologies is essential for stakeholders aiming to stay competitive. By understanding the distinct advantages of AI, businesses can successfully navigate the complex landscape of an increasingly interconnected economy.

The Role of AI in Enhancing Customer Experiences
Another significant impact of Artificial Intelligence (AI) on global markets is its ability to revolutionize customer experiences. As consumers demand more personalized and responsive interactions, businesses are leveraging AI to meet these expectations in innovative ways. By enhancing customer experiences, organizations can not only build loyalty but also gain valuable insights into consumer preferences.
One effective application of AI in this area is through customer service chatbots. These AI-driven tools can handle customer inquiries in real-time, providing instant responses to common questions and resolving issues without the need for human intervention. This allows businesses to maintain 24/7 service availability, significantly improving customer satisfaction levels. For example, a major retail chain might deploy a chatbot on its website and mobile app, enabling shoppers to get assistance anytime, which can lead to increased conversion rates and decreased cart abandonment rates.
Moreover, AI systems can analyze customer data to deliver personalized recommendations. For instance, streaming platforms such as Netflix utilize AI algorithms to suggest shows and movies based on users’ viewing habits and preferences. This level of personalization not only enhances the user experience but also keeps customers engaged, as they are more likely to discover content that resonates with them. Retailers can implement similar strategies by using AI to analyze purchase history and browsing behavior, allowing them to tailor product recommendations geared specifically toward individual customers.
Furthermore, AI technologies enable businesses to gather and analyze feedback with greater precision. Tools like sentiment analysis can scrutinize customer reviews and social media interactions to gauge public perception of a brand or product. This capability equips companies with the insights needed to address areas of concern proactively, thus fostering a more robust brand image. For instance, a food company might use AI to analyze social media comments about a new snack product, identifying positive feedback along with common complaints. Armed with this information, they can make adjustments to the recipe or marketing strategy quickly.
The integration of AI into predictive customer analytics also plays a crucial role. By harnessing AI’s ability to process large datasets, companies can identify emerging trends and patterns that signal shifts in consumer behavior. For instance, during economic downturns, consumers may exhibit changes in spending habits. Businesses that rely on AI to track these trends can adapt their offerings accordingly, ensuring they remain competitive and relevant in a fluctuating marketplace.
Moreover, personalization extends to marketing strategies through AI. Businesses can analyze consumer engagement data to optimize their advertising campaigns, ensuring they reach the right audience at the right time. Platforms like Google and Facebook utilize AI to enhance targeted advertising, thereby maximizing return on investment for their Advertisers. By identifying which demographics are most responsive to different messages, companies can tailor their approach, increasing the efficacy of their marketing efforts.
Overall, AI serves as a powerful enabler in creating exceptional customer experiences, which in turn affects the dynamics of global markets. Organizations that embrace these technologies not only enhance customer satisfaction but also position themselves advantageously in an increasingly competitive landscape.
